Director James Cameron: Avatar to Get Sequel Trilogy

posted on by Lynzee Loveridge

The entertainment news website Deadline reported that director James Cameron's Avatar sequels will span three films instead of the previously stated two. According to the site, the films are scheduled to be shot back-to-back, with Avatar 2 opening December 2016, Avatar 3 following in December 2017, and Avatar 4 a year later.

Cameron previously stated that he plans to start developing the live-action adaptation of Yukito Kishiro's Battle Angel Alita (GUNNM) manga in 2017.

Cameron previously stated the film would not start until after Avatar 2 and 3. Cameron also plans to direct The Informationist film based on a book by Taylor Stevens after he finishes directing the sequels to his Avatar film.
